Challenges in Pipeline Construction
Amid the expanding need for power facilities, different difficulties make complex the construction of pipelines. Among the primary problems is the geographical irregularity of pipe paths, which can go across diverse landscapes, consisting of hills, rivers, and urban locations. Each setting needs tailored design remedies to deal with environmental defense, geological security, and logistical constraints.Additionally, the public assumption of pipeline jobs usually presents a significant difficulty. Regional neighborhoods may reveal issues concerning prospective environmental impacts, security threats, and disruption throughout construction. This opposition can result in hold-ups, raised expenses, and the necessity for extensive community involvement approaches to promote acceptance.Moreover, labor shortages in skilled professions even more complicate pipe construction efforts. As the need for power facilities expands, the schedule of knowledgeable workers diminishes, which can lead to job delays and enhanced labor expenses. The pipeline industry must spend in labor force growth campaigns to grow a competent labor force with the ability of satisfying the progressing demands.Safety continues to be a paramount issue throughout the construction procedure. The sector deals with the challenge of ensuring that all safety and security methods are complied with, as even minor gaps can result in significant accidents. This demands rigorous training and oversight to keep operational integrity.Lastly, varying material expenses can influence project budget plans and timelines. The requirement for top quality products, combined with market volatility, needs mindful economic planning and threat reduction strategies to maintain tasks on the right track. Addressing these difficulties is essential for the effective and reliable construction of pipelines as component of a durable energy framework.
Governing Framework and Conformity
The regulative structure regulating pipeline construction is complicated and complex, needing conformity with a selection of government, state, and regional laws. At the federal level, agencies such as the Federal Power Regulatory Commission (FERC) and the Pipeline and Hazardous Products Safety Administration (PHMSA) play important roles in overseeing pipe jobs. FERC controls the transport of gas and oil, approving tasks based on financial need and public rate of interest, while PHMSA concentrates on safety and security standards and the stability of pipe operations.State guidelines can differ considerably, with individual states enforcing their own allowing procedures, safety policies, and environmental assessments. For instance, state utility commissions may require extra examination of suggested paths to ensure very little interruption to browse around this site neighborhoods and ecosystems. Compliance with the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A) is likewise required, mandating thorough ecological impact evaluations prior to task approval.Local laws might further make complex the conformity landscape, as communities usually have certain zoning legislations, land use guidelines, and neighborhood involvement needs. Involving with local stakeholders is not only a governing requirement but additionally an ideal practice to facilitate smoother task execution.Moreover, the governing landscape is continually developing, affected by public sentiment, technical innovations, and ecological policies, demanding constant vigilance from pipeline drivers. Steering with this elaborate governing framework is necessary for confirming that pipeline construction tasks are not just legally compliant but additionally socially responsible and environmentally sustainable, therefore adding to the overall efficiency of energy infrastructure advancement.
